Made for mission mobility and security
Tamper-resistant aluminum shell: The outer housing shields internal components from damage and includes locking features that flag tampering. Rated IP67, it’s waterproof and dustproof.
USB-C port with power passthrough: A single sealed connection supports fast data transfer and USB power delivery, reducing cable clutter and enabling quick, secure setup.
Encrypted Linux system accessory: An optional module adds wireless capability with an embedded Linux system for real-time encryption, secure data handling, and built-in diagnostics.

Project Overview
A rugged biometric terminal
Javelin™ began as a biometric device developed by Xator to collect iris and fingerprint data in the field. We joined the program early, supporting the embedded system and firmware design.
When Parsons acquired Xator, they inherited the Javelin platform and chose to keep us involved. We carried the work forward, redesigning the electronics, adding power passthrough, and creating a tamper-resistant housing ready for field production.
Today we manage full production for Parsons, applying deep system knowledge to deliver a compact tool trusted by military, law enforcement, and humanitarian teams.
The Challenge
Secure identity captured in a tight, tactical footprint
Operators carry the Javelin device into unpredictable, high-risk situations like border checkpoints, forward operating bases, and humanitarian zones with limited infrastructure. The device has to scan irises and fingerprints, encrypt data in real time, and transmit it through a single USB-C connection. All of those features have to fit inside a compact housing that could mount to standard Juggernaut gear without overheating or breaking on impact.
The original prototype had promise but lacked the system-level refinement needed to survive these environments. With the program shifting from Xator to Parsons, we also had to preserve knowledge and momentum while reworking the device for full production.
